The most recent incident happened just after midnight Thursday on Green Bay's east side.
A 29-year-old woman said she had been sitting in her living room working on her laptop when she noticed a naked man outside her window. She went to see if her door was locked and the man ran off, police said.
The man has been described as thin and white.
Police said the incident might be connected to one that happened Wednesday night in Allouez.
Three children in a home reported seeing a man wearing only a bandanna outside their glass patio door about 11 p.m., police said.
